Fractal Analytics  (NSE:FRACTAL) Interest Expense Explanation

Interest Coverage is a ratio that determines how easily a company can pay interest expenses on outstanding debt. It is calculated by dividing a company's Operating Income (EBIT) by its Interest Expense. The higher, the better.

Note: If both Interest Expense and Interest Income are empty, while Net Interest Income is negative, then use Net Interest Income as Interest Expense.

Fractal Analytics's Interest Expense for the six months ended in Mar. 2026 was ₹-254 Mil. Its Operating Income for the six months ended in Mar. 2026 was ₹2,246 Mil. And its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the six months ended in Mar. 2026 was ₹921 Mil.

Fractal Analytics's Interest Coverage for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Interest Coverage=-1* Operating Income (Q: Mar. 2026 )/Interest Expense (Q: Mar. 2026 )
=-1*2246/-254
=8.84

Fractal Analytics Business Description

Other Exchanges 544700:India
Address Off Western Express Highway, Level 7, Commerz II, International Business Park, Oberoi Garden City, Goregaon East, Mumbai, MH, IND, 400 063
Fractal Analytics Ltd is engaged in the business of providing products and/or services relating to conversational AI solutions that enable automated, human-like conversations between organisations and people. The company operates through two business segments: (i) Fractal.ai, which provides AI services and products to develop customized solutions for client-specific use cases across industry-specific and cross-industry applications, and (ii) Fractal Alpha, which includes AI-related business activities. Through these segments, the company serves clients across various industries and business functions. The majority of the company's revenue is derived from the Fractal.ai segment. Geographically, it operates in the United States of America, Europe and APAC & Others.
